Question

When two elements of a pair are connected such that they can only turn about a fixed axis of another element, they are called ________.

A.

a spherical pair

B.

a turning pair 

C.

a screw pair

D.

a sliding pair

Answer ( Option B)

a turning pair 

Solution

●Inspherical pair one link which is in spherical shape is turned inside a fixed link.

●In turning pairone link has a turning or revolving motion relative to the other. The link are connected in such manner that they can only turn/revolve about a fixed axis of another element.

●In screw pair two mating links have a turning as well as sliding motion between them.

●In a sliding pair two links have sliding motion relative to each other.

●In a rolling pair two links of a pair have a rolling motion relative to each other.

Hence, the correct option is (B).
